Understanding Pulp Molding
Pulp molding is a manufacturing process that involves creating products from recycled paper and cardboard. This process is not only eco-friendly but also versatile, allowing for the production of various items such as trays, containers, and even custom packaging solutions. The key to this process lies in the machines that efficiently shape and cut the pulp material.
The Role of a Pulp Molding Rotary Cutting Machine
What is a Pulp Molding Rotary Cutting Machine?
A Pulp Molding Rotary Cutting Machine is designed to produce and cut molds from pulp. Its rotary function allows it to operate continuously, making it highly efficient for mass production. This machine utilizes a combination of heat, pressure, and precision cutting to create molded products that can range from simple shapes to complex designs.
How Does It Work?
Material Preparation: The process begins with the preparation of the pulp. Recycled paper and cardboard are shredded and mixed with water to create a slurry. This mixture is then poured into a mold.
Molding Process: The pulp is scooped into molds that are situated on a rotary drum. As the drum rotates, the molds fill with the slurry, allowing it to take shape. The rotation helps evenly distribute the material and ensures consistent thickness.

Cutting: Once the molded products are dry, they move to the cutting phase. Here, the Pulp Molding Rotary Cutting Machine employs sharp, rotary blades to trim excess pulp and create the final shape. This precision cutting ensures each product meets specific size and quality standards.
Finishing Touches: The finished products are then inspected, often undergoing additional treatment for strength and durability before being packaged for distribution.
Benefits of Using a Pulp Molding Rotary Cutting Machine
- Sustainability: This machine promotes recycling by using waste materials, significantly reducing environmental impact.
- Cost-Effective: With high efficiency and low labor costs, this machine can significantly lower production expenses.
- Versatility: Manufacturers can create a wide variety of products, catering to different market needs with ease.
- Consistency: The automated process ensures high uniformity in production, leading to better quality control.
